Established in 1947. Over 200 retailers in Japan. One of Osaka’s most well-known udon restaurant chains. Boasting of such eminent pedigree on their web site, how was Kazokutei in Bugis Junction wallowing at 2.9 stars on Google?

Food for ants, with restaurant prices to match,” declared one overview, “Paid $19 for my set meal, sat in hunger for 30 minutes amidst an average crowd… finished this serving… within 3 mouthfuls.

One of the worst things I’ve ever eaten. Their omurice is not fit to be named omurice,” mentioned one other and I dutifully added omurice to the listing of issues to strive. I learn a criticism of “Very salty soup base”, so soup could be on my menu, too.

This collection on the worst-rated stalls in Singapore has to date coated 2 institutions they usually have each over-performed once I visited to see for myself. Would Kazokutei make it a trifecta of nice surprises? My colleague and I actually hoped in order we made our manner all the way down to Bugis final week.

Kazokutei was nearly abandoned. A gentleman dined by himself on the desk subsequent to ours whereas a trio of older girls occupied one other desk additional away. Always carrying my optimist’s hat for this collection, I concluded this meant quick service and the seats of our selection. Great begin, proper?

What I attempted at Kazokutei

I used to be certainly pleased with the service— our orders had been taken promptly and the dishes arrived inside 10 minutes. It contradicted the “Service was bad – claimed after 20 mins that the kitchen was slow” warning in one among 1-star opinions that aligned with a number of of the others.

Our first dish was the Seafood Tom Yam Nabeyaki Udon (S$14.90), which got here in an outsized bowl. I might counsel to administration that they substitute the present bowls for smaller ones— the serving was average at finest however the huge unoccupied house within the bowl made it appear particularly meagre.

In the bowl with the udon had been 3 cockles, 1 massive prawn, 2 tofu items, a clump of enoki mushrooms and a whole lot of cabbage.

To me, the soup was salty however my eating companion discovered it acceptable. We each agreed that it was diluted, missing the richness we affiliate with tom yum. Perhaps it was this dilution and lack of different substances that made it particularly bitter, too.

I immediately remorse tasting the udon. It had the weirdest texture of any noodles I’ve ever eaten. This dish was a disappointment and we paid S$1 for bottled water, too.

We had been actually hoping that the Pork Cutlet Omu Rice (S$12.90) could be higher, partly to have the ability to say that the meals was common, at the least, but additionally to take away the style of the tom yum udon from our mouths.

It was to not be.

The omu rice was a shocker. What was offered to us as tomato rice tasted like common moist rice tossed in some Heinz tomato ketchup (which might be an insult to Heinz).

Taking a better have a look at the cutlet, we may see a skinny layer of raw batter beneath the crispy pores and skin. One chunk confirmed that it was certainly frozen meat, presumably thawed improperly. When we introduced this to the eye of the waitress, she mentioned that it was regular.

This actually was getting worse by the minute.

Really, how are you going to get french fries fallacious? I’d perceive if the place was bustling, with the chef overlooking the prepare dinner time as a result of orders are flying in by the second. When we visited, the place was nearly empty and the fries had been nonetheless semi-cooked.

The skinny omelette was acceptable, making it the most effective factor on the plate.

Final ideas

In discovering and attempting Singapore’s worst-rated locations to eat, my intention has all the time been to attempt to see the silver lining. Both the primary and second worst-rated locations I visited labored out precisely that manner. I can’t inform if that was as a result of they’d been unfairly rated or whether or not the operators had listened to suggestions and turned issues round.

I’m sorry to say that the successful streak has come to an finish at Kazokutei. Besides the much-maligned service, which proved to be considerably higher than the opinions had prompt, all our worst fears had been confirmed throughout our go to.

Perhaps most disappointing was the nonchalant response to our suggestions. Rather than specific contrition or ask if we want to have the dish changed, the employees’s response was to say that the dishes had been meant to be ready that manner. Unfortunate.

I’d learn the other however, to be truthful, I’ll add that each employees member was well mannered all through the method. If administration at Kazokutei can put money into some additional coaching for his or her prepare dinner employees, maybe they can flip issues round. Fingers crossed.

Expected harm: S$12.90 – S$25 per pax
